eClinicalWorks RATED A TOP EMR SYSTEM FOR SMALL, MEDIUM AND LARGE
PRACTICES AT TEPR 2006
Integrated EMR and Practice Management Solution Also Wins
Pediatric Award Challenge
WESTBOROUGH, Mass.—May 26, 2006—eClinicalWorks™, a leading provider
of unified ambulatory clinical information systems, today announced it has
received First Honors at the 2006 TEPR (Towards the Electronic Patient
Record) Awards, in the category of EMR Systems for Medium and Large
Practices, and Second Honors in the EMR System for Small Practices category.
The company also received First Honors in the Pediatric specialty category.
The awards were presented during the 22nd Annual TEPR 2006 Conference and
Exhibition, held May 20-24, 2006 at the Baltimore Convention Center.

Organized by the Medical Records Institute, the TEPR Awards recognize
outstanding healthcare solutions. The TEPR Conference and Exhibition has
worked to advance electronic patient records for 22 years, providing
attendees with a comprehensive educational program and an exhibition
showcasing nearly 200 leading EHR/EMR and related technology vendors. TEPR
is considered one of the Health IT industry’s premier events and a
highly-regarded awards program. Other recipients of this award include
Allscripts (Nasdaq: MDRX), Medical Communication Systems and Practice
Partner.
eClinicalWorks also won First Honors in the Pediatric specialty category. In
order to claim top honors in this category, participants demonstrate their
software at the Pediatrics Clinical Documentation Challenge (CDC). At the
CDC, vendors are given difficult, short pediatric scenarios to document
based on special requirements for pediatric electronic medical records.
Vendors are scored in how well and how efficiently they can handle each
scenario.

About eClinicalWorks
Founded in 1999, eClinicalWorks is an established, profitable private
clinical information technology company. Its independent, investor-free
structure provides the agility to quickly meet market requirements. The
company’s Electronic Medical Record (EMR) and Practice Management (PM)
solutions are proven for solo, single/multi-specialty and
single/multi-location practice networks, and designed to streamline a
practices operations to ensure superior patient care. eClinicalWorks has an
established customer base of more than 5,000 medical providers across all 50
states. eClinicalWorks has been awarded top industry honors including Best
in KLAS’ Ambulatory EMR (1-5) in 2005 and 2004, a top EMR for small, medium
and large practices by TEPR 2006, the best EMR and EMR-e- prescription by
TEPR 2005, the top Practice Management solution and Medical Records Document
Imaging/Management System by TEPR 2004, the top EMR solution by TEPR 2003
and the 5-STAR rated EMR solution by AC Group in 2002, 2003 and 2004. Based
in Westborough, Mass., eClinicalWorks has additional offices in Roswell, Ga.
